India says terrorism to dominate forthcoming talks with Pakistan

Foreign Secretary Nirupama Rao said in London that India is disturbed by the call for jihad by certain elements in Pakistan. She made it clear that terrorism will dominate the forthcoming Foreign Secretary-level talks.<br/><br/>Speaking at a conference Mrs. Rao said, India has consistently maintained that Pakistan should bring perpetrators of the Mumbai terror attacks to trial expeditiously and dismantle terror infrastructure on its soil. She added that it is in this connection that Pakistan's Foreign Secretary Salman Bashir has been invited for talks in New Delhi on February 25. Mrs Rao said, Pakistan has taken certain steps against terrorism in a selective manner which is meaningless.<br/><br/>On the same issue, the Foreign Minister S M Krishna said, all issues concerning the relations between the two countries will be taken up during the forthcoming talks.
